Webber stays as number two - Marko

Red Bull advisor Helmut Marko says Mark Webber will be the number two to Sebastian Vettel in 2013. Vettel secured his third consecutive world championship last season as Red Bull also won the constructors' title, while Webber finished the year in sixth in the drivers' standings. As a result, Vettel has finished higher than Webber in the championship in each of the four years that they have been team-mates at Red Bull, and Marko says he doesn't expect that to change in the new season.
